Cas Curason is a family replacement home for people from the age of 18 who have an intellectual disability.
​
-
The residents are self-reliant to a certain extent, but depend on 24-hour care and guidance;
-
Most residents go to daycare during the day;
-
The residents in the family replacement home together form a "family";
-
Residents share the living room, patio, activity room, small kitchen, bathrooms, and bedrooms;
-
All residents receive help from a fixed group of supervisors; and
-
​The family replacement home is located in a residential area.
​​
It is a small form of housing that currently offers 17 clients a place to live. By means of the following activities, the home tries to offer support in a systematic way in the development of the following products, based on its own request for help and wishes, together with meaningful people in its environment:
1. housing skills;
2. a meaningful daily and leisure activity;
3. establishing and maintaining social contacts (network); and
4. Participate in a variety of educational, sporting, social and
social activities.

CAS BRIYANTE
LOCATION
CAS BRIYANTE
PALISIAWEG 100
SAN NICOLAAS
The care centre, which can accommodate 20 clients, is a residential care centre for people with (severe) multiple disabilities. The care center offers the most complete possible range of care for clients in one center.
​
• Residents have 24-hour support and need guidance;
• Most residents go to daycare during the day;
• Residents share the living areas like the patio,
small kitchen, bathrooms and bedrooms;
• All residents receive help from a fixed group (assistant)
supervisors and nurses; and
• The residential care center is located in a residential area.
​
Cas Briyante consists of 3 residential units and a large central building. The daytime activities provided by another foundation are located in the central building. Cas Briyante also offers 1 crisis placement where a client who is in a crisis situation can be temporarily accommodated.
​
The program of housing that is provided serves to:
-
Supporting the client in care and/or nursing;
-
Supporting the client in rehabilitation;
-
​Provide support in all day-to-day activities;
-
​Encourage the client, where possible, to take the initiative; and
-
To offer the client opportunities for activation, socialization, participation and integration into society.
​​
The program of daytime activities that is offered by SVGA at the location focuses on the following:
-
Activities give clients the opportunity to be active and gain experience;
-
By moving, acting, manipulating and exploring materials, clients learn and practice skills in various development domains;
-
Clients are given the opportunity to influence the environment and to become aware of their possibilities;
-
Through activities, interaction with others also takes place and relationships can be strengthened; and
-
Activities give structure and rhythm to the day, they provide variety. Adapted activities evoke positive feelings and can help prevent negative feelings (in extreme cases leading to problem behaviour). One is given the opportunity to participate in society... and in short, the chance to have fun.
